How to Buy an Electric Kitchen Composter

This quick guide explains what to look for when buying an electric kitchen composter, compares the main types, highlights must-have features, explains where to buy, and gives practical tips so you can choose the right unit for your home faster.

Key factors to consider

Capacity and household size: choose a capacity that matches how much food waste you produce. Options range from about 3 L for small households to 19 L for larger families.
Processing speed and throughput: models process waste in 4 to 8 hours or run continuously; check the daily processing limit (some units handle up to about 11 lb per day).
Compost quality: some machines use microbial degradation to produce true compost while others dehydrate or grind into pre-compost. Decide if you need ready-to-use nutrient material or a pre-compost that needs curing.
Odour control and filters: look for proven deodorization systems and know whether filters are permanent or replaceable. Replaceable carbon filters add ongoing cost.
Noise and placement: quieter units operate around 40 dB and are better for apartment or countertop use.
Maintenance and cleaning: check for self-cleaning cycles, removable non-stick buckets, and how often filters or parts must be replaced.
Power use and smart features: consider energy draw, app or WiFi features for tracking, and whether remote controls matter to you.
Price and warranty: expect a wide price range; compare included warranties and spare part availability.

Types and how they work

Microbial degradation units - use microbes to break down food into richer, plant-ready compost in hours; often promoted as producing "true" compost.
Thermal grind and dehydrate units - use heat and grinding to reduce volume and sanitize; output may need extra curing before gardening use.
Continuous add versus batch units - continuous units let you drop scraps in anytime; batch units require filling and running a cycle.
Countertop versus larger capacity units - countertop models (3 L to 5 L) suit couples or small families; larger cabinets or 10+ L units suit busy households or light commercial use.
Self-cleaning and smart models - some offer auto-clean cycles and app connectivity to monitor cycles and track carbon footprint.

Where to buy and common mistakes to avoid

Online retail - best for selection, price comparisons, customer reviews, and delivery options. Confirm shipping times, return policy, and warranty support before buying.
Brick and mortar - good if you want to check footprint and noise in person before committing.
Common mistakes to avoid:
  • Buying a unit that is too small for your household waste volume.
  • Ignoring ongoing filter or supply costs when the model uses replaceable filters.
  • Assuming every machine makes ready-to-use compost; some outputs need further curing.
  • Overlooking noise level if the unit will sit in the kitchen.
  • Failing to check warranty and spare part availability.

Expert tips and quick checklist

Match capacity to your weekly waste - 3 L is fine for 1 to 2 people, 4 to 5 L for small families, 10+ L or continuous units for larger households.
Prioritize odour control and a low-maintenance filter system - permanent filters save money over time.
If you want minimal babysitting, pick a self-cleaning continuous-add model.
Check processing time and daily throughput if you cook a lot; faster cycles and higher reduction rates reduce trips to the trash.
Buy from a seller with clear returns and a warranty; look for at least a year of coverage.
Quick checklist:
  • Capacity and daily throughput
  • Processing method and compost readiness
  • Noise level and footprint
  • Filter type and replacement cost
  • Self-clean and maintenance needs
  • Warranty and return policy

Final Thoughts

Choose a unit by balancing capacity, maintenance and compost quality. For busy households prioritise larger capacity and continuous-add or fast-cycle microbial units with strong odour control and permanent filters. For small households prioritise quiet countertop models with easy cleaning. Always check warranty, filter costs, and return policy before you buy.
